Avalia O1
Avaliação 1
1. O que são software personalizados?
a) São softwares desenvolvidos para serem vendidos a todo o tipo de clientes.
b) São softwares desenvolvidos para um determinado cliente, segundo as suas especificações. c) São softwares desenvolvidos para um determinado cliente, seguindo especificações padrão.
2. Atividades comuns a todos os processos de software:
a) Especificações, desenvolvimento, testes, manutenção.
b) Desenvolvimento, especificações, manutenção.
c) Especificações, desenvolvimento, testes.
3. Quais as atividades do processo de desenvolvimento de software?
a) Especificação, Desenho e Implementação, Validação e Manutenção.
b) Planeamento, Desenho, Desenvolvimento e Instalação.
c) Estudo, Desenho, Codificação e Implementação.
d) Especificação, Desenho e Desenvolvimento.
4. O processo de desenvolvimento de software é:
a) O processo de estabelecer quais os serviços e as restrições que são exigidas na operação e desenvolvimento do sistema.
b) Um modelo de processo moderno que deriva do UML.
c) Um conjunto de atividades exigidas para o desenvolvimento de um sistema de software. d) A distribuição do sistema no seu ambiente operacional.
5. O modelo baseado em componentes:
a) É a instalação de diferentes componentes de diversos sistemas para que funcionem em conjunto.
b) Baseia-se na reutilização sistemática, onde os sistemas são integrados por componentes existentes ou por sistemas “de prateleira”.
c) Baseia-se na utilização de várias pessoas para desenvolverem um único sistema.
d) Nenhuma das anteriores.
6. Como define o processo de iteração no processo de desenvolvimento de software?
a) É o processo em que cada atividade interage com outras para atingirem o sistema final. b) É o desenvolvimento de software num só processo.
c) É o desenvolvimento de software ignorando um ou mais processos para cumprir os requisitos. d) Repetição das atividades dos processos de desenvolvimento de software para responder às